College/Department Information
Laboratory Information The laboratory's research focuses on clinical and laboratory research on the mechanisms of visual function and dysfunction. Highly motivated applicants with prior experience in laboratory research and computer programming are encouraged to apply. Department Information The Department of Neuroscience and Regenerative Medicine (DNRM) is ideally aligned with the national mandate for greater translation of basic research from the lab bench to the patient's bedside. With strong support from AU and the University System of Georgia, DNRM brings together nationally recognized scientists and clinicians unlock the unsolved mysteries of major illnesses such as schizophrenia, stroke, Alzheimer's disease, Parkinson's disease and multiple sclerosis. It is the goal of DNRM to create an exciting, highly interactive environment for cutting-edge research and to make discoveries that will bring great benefits to people. DNRM will also serve as a magnet for philanthropy by individuals and foundations with an interest in finding the causes and cures for numerous neurological and behavior disorders that have adversely impacted their families and communities.

Responsibilities
The duties include, but are not limited to:
  • Working with human subjects regularly, carrying out psychophysical (behavioral) experiments on study subjects, and assisting the Principal Investigator (Pl) and other lab personnel in various experiments involving neuroimaging and eye-tracking in human subjects.
  • General management for labs, including (but not limited to) maintaining the laboratory, including ordering reagents, equipment, software etc for the lab, ensuring compliance with all applicable study protocols, and cleaning and maintenance of laboratory equipment.
  • Other related duties as assigned by the PI.

Required Qualifications

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in chemistry, biology, biochemistry, cell biology or other natural, life, health care or materials science directly related to the research area to which the position is assigned and experience in a research, basic science or clinical setting particularly clinical trials research. OR Associate's degree from an accredited college or university in chemistry, biology, biochemistry, cell biology or other natural, life, health care or materials science directly related to the research area to which the position is assigned and a minimum of three years' experience in a research, basic science or clinical setting particularly clinical trials research.
